How they compare
Jordan currently reports 0.9751 current LCU per US$ of GDP against 0.9296 current LCU per US$ of GDP in Croatia, a difference of 0.0455 current LCU per US$ of GDP.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 13 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Jordan ahead.
Croatia ranks 158th and Jordan ranks 155th of 186 countries.
Croatia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Gross national expenditure (current LCU)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
